2017-08-03 12 views
0

選択するオプションが多数あるselectステートメントがあります。私はバックエンドからすべてのオプションを取得していますが、バックエンドから渡すオプションも選択したいと思います。私のコードは次の通りです:Laravelでselectステートメントをあらかじめ選択する方法

これで、テキストフィールドは完全に機能し、それに応じて入力されますが、選択入力に適切なオプションを選択できません。どんな助け? jQueryやJavaScriptを使用せずにこれを行うことはできますか?

+0

''タグがどのように動作するかについての簡単な研究では、あなた自身がこれに答えるでしょう。 – charlietfl

答えて

2

あなたのようなマッチした値は持っているオプションを選択する必要があります

<td> 
    <select class="form-control" name="TB1_instructions_course[]" id="course"> 
     <option value="">Course</option> 
     @foreach($info['staticInfo']['courses'] as $course) 
      @if ($course['course'] == $info['userInfo']['courses'][$i]) 
       <option value="{{$course['course']}}" selected="selected">{{$course['course']}}</option> 
      @else 
       <option value="{{$course['course']}}">{{$course['course']}}</option> 
      @endif 
     @endforeach 
    </select> 
</td> 

注:オプションは(私の例で追加)value属性を持っている必要があります。

これが役に立ちます。

+0

完全に動作しますが、このアプローチについては考えていませんでした。ありがとう!私の質問に答えてマークします – Muhammad

関連する問題